Abstract EN
Parkinson’s disease (PD) is a common neurodegenerative disease in the middle-aged and the elderly.
Symptoms of autonomic dysfunctions are frequently seen in PD patients, severely affecting the quality of life.
This review summarizes the epidemiology, clinical manifestations, and treatment options of autonomic dysfunctions.
The clinical significance of autonomic dysfunctions in PD early diagnosis and differential diagnosis is also discussed.
